[iOS] Handheld.PlayFullScreenMovie is not working on 5.2
To Reproduce:
1. Deploy the attached project.
2. Observe that none of the videos can be found. When calling Handheld.PlayFullScreenMovie, the screen just flickers on iOS8/9 on iOS7 a warning in Xcode console that the video couldn't be found is printed out.
Tested on iOS 7/8/9
Exactly same project works fine on 5.1.1f1 (2046fc06d4d8)
Seems that the video file is not copied to the iOS app (or the path is wrong) (see comment).
